Output 41e264dfc7145bcf34b579f6cb6539c03beaa0add49d50d8eb64a30dc892427d:0

value
39560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f3fc62ea572502480bb5dc891c271ca779c5b6 OP_EQUALVERIFY OP_CHECKSIG
address
1MEacqCMgHUuSf9vDhkWXnVpwy4GAbqjZr
transaction
41e264dfc7145bcf34b579f6cb6539c03beaa0add49d50d8eb64a30dc892427d